How is it guided?

Follow the COLORS.

In the downloadable-print-ready free PDF file, I’ve marked:

  • All five minor blues scale positions’ root notes (Glossary Link) in a Red circle.
  • The blues notes themselves (b5) are marked in a Purple square,
    so you’ll learn to differentiate and isolate them from the basic 5-notes minor pentatonic patterns.

Additionally, I’ve marked with a Blue triangle the major pentatonic root note found in each position (Don’t confuse it with the Major Blues scale).

so you’ll have a kind of map or grid if you may, to “visualize” three key elements in each position.

In my experience, developing this map-like vision is one of the most effective ways to navigate the fingerboard quickly when improvising over blues chord progressions.

In the long run, it will give you a significant advantage—so consider it a bonus!

In the following sheet, all five shapes are shown in the key of A minor Blues Scale (that’s why I included the fret numbers), and of course, once understood and memorized, you can move them anywhere you want on the fretboard to play in different keys.

Important:

  • The numbers within the circles, squares, or triangles represent the fingers you’re supposed to press with (the “correct” fingering).
  • The suggested fingerings are for basic memorization only.
    Eventually, exploring and deciding what fingering works best under your fingers is up to you so your playing flows comfortably and smoothly.
